Led by a record-breaking perforamnce by junior Chelsea Socha (Himrod, N.Y./Dundee), the Keuka women’s cross country team placed 18th out of 23 teams at the SUNY Geneseo Invitational this weekend.  The 6K race was held at Letchworth State Park.

Keuka finished with a team score of 511 while Geneseo won the race with a score of 41.  SUNY Brockport placed second with a score of 92 and was followed by the Geneseo Alumni (95), Rochester (122), and Laurentian (155).

Socha turned in a 16th place finish out of 216 runners.  Her time of 23:31 shattered the previous Keuka College record for a 6K race of 24:07 set back in 2003. 

Freshman Stephanie Pontes (Pompton Lakes, NJ/Pompton Lakes) placed 153rd in a time of 28:40 while classmate Elizbeth Gorman (Waverly, N.Y./Waverly) was the Storm’s third finisher in 172nd place (29:33).

Sophomores Heather Fischer (Marietta, N.Y./Tully) and Maddie Reynolds (Clinton, N.Y./Clinton) rounded out Keuka’s top-five.  Fischer in 201st place (33:27) and Reynolds in 206th place (35:14).

The Storm will next compete in the Nazareth College Invitational this Saturday, Oct. 10.
